A Dense Hedge of Color, Quickly
Why Tri-Color Dappled Willow Shrubs?
The Tri-Color Willow Hedge Shrub, or 'Dappled Willow', is an amazing new shrub that can be planted to form a colorful 8 to 10-foot privacy hedge. Heavy branching means that the stunning Tri-Color Willow grows quickly and beautifully.
In fact, you can expect a full hedge after the first few growing seasons, along with ethereal beauty that makes an effortlessly elegant statement. Even better? It's easy to prune if you want it kept short.
And its rounded or weeping silhouette makes it a great accent plant as well. Put one at the corner of your home to liven up dull spots with vivacious, eye-catching vibrancy.
Plus, new growth emerges with a rich pink tint that leaves a fresh impression. During spring, your Dappled Willow Shrub will come alive, with an array of branches full of light green foliage and a hint of white on each leaf. The Tri-Color truly lives up to its name in color variation and graceful good looks.

Rough Start But Years Later They Are Strong!
I planted about a dozen of these dappled willows about 4-5 years ago. Despite being deer resistant the deer chowed down on them 2 years in a row. I had to pull 1 or 2 bushes out of the ground because they died. The others survived and most of them are huge 8-10ft tall. I plan to plant a dozen more and this time I’m going to fence them off until they mature. All in all I highly recommend them with the understanding that deer will eat anything.

After 6 years
When I got these in the Spring 2020, these were single sticks about knee high. THEY ARE GIANTS NOW! (That's a 6' privacy fence in the photo for reference) I trim them every year to shape, but if I had left them alone, they would have dominated everything around them. They get full sun, I don't water them, but my area gets abundant rainfall. They do get pretty gnarly looking in the winter, but for me that's November though March. I have a field out back and I'm curious to see what one would do planted on it's own out there.
